Как добавить таймер между контроллерами цикла, вызываемыми в одном потоке в JMeter - PullRequest
0 голосов
/ 05 марта 2019

Я добавил jmx-скрипт в JMeter5.0 с двумя контроллерами цикла, вызываемыми в потоке.двухконтурные контроллеры:

  1. Логин пользователя
  2. Выход пользователя из системы

Я хочу, чтобы все мои пользователи из CSV одновременно входили в систему, а затем выходили из нее сразу,который работает нормально, но перед следующим входом в систему, я хочу некоторую задержку (после контроллера выхода из системы).

Установка постоянного таймера сделает задержку во всех запросах вместо контроллеров цикла.

1 Ответ

0 голосов
/ 05 марта 2019

Обратите внимание, что [правила определения объема] JMeter выполняют таймеры до сэмплеры

2.Таймеры

3.Sampler

Так что либо поместите Timer как дочерний элемент первого сэмплера в Login Controller (это добавит задержку также при первом входе в систему)

, либо добавьте Flow Control Action в конце контроллера Logoutс таймером в качестве дочернего элемента

он позволяет включать паузы без необходимости генерировать образец.Для переменных задержек установите время паузы на ноль и добавьте таймер в качестве дочернего элемента.

...